Under the direction of the

Chief Nursing Officer / Director of Nursing ,

Nurse Manager or Charge Nurse , the

Registered Nurse (RN)

is responsible for utilizing the nursing process while delivering, directing and supervising care to patients admitted to the nursing unit. The Registered Nurse plans, coordinates, and provides patient care to include interdisciplinary planning, discharge planning, patient and family teaching for post-hospitalization, and accessing community resources. May perform other related duties as assigned or requested, including Charge Nurse (ACLS certification required).

Education and Training
Holds a current licensure as a registered nurse (RN) in the state where the hospital resides, or compact licensure if the state participates. Current BLS certification is required. Evidence of ACLS certification is required within 90 days of employment. BLS and ACLS certifications must be AHA approved within 90 days of employment. Current ACLS certification is required for Charge Nurses.

Experience
One year of inpatient medical-surgical nursing experience preferred but not required.
